A 70-year-old man on Saturday morning died following an accident on the Danielstown Access Road, Essequibo Coast, which left his vehicle partially submerged in a nearby trench.
According to the police, Royston Peterson of Devonshire Castle, Essequibo Coast, was driving west along the southern driveway of the Danielstown Access Road around 22:00hrs on Friday when, in trying to negotiate a turn, he plunged into a trench.
Rendered unconscious, Peterson, who was smelling of alcohol, was rescued by passers-by and rushed to the Suddie Hospital, where he was treated and stabilised. Unfortunately, he died at around 05:45hrs on Saturday morning.
The other occupant of the vehicle miraculously escaped unhurt, and was able to confirm to the police that Peterson had indeed been drinking.
